Systematic work is underway in Uzbekistan to harmonize international standards with national standards.
This contributes to the introduction of modern requirements across various sectors of the economy, improving the quality of products and services, and strengthening competitiveness in foreign markets.
As a result of efforts by the Uzbek Agency for Technical Regulation, the level of harmonization has reached 43.9 percent, indicating the effectiveness of the reforms being implemented in technical regulation.
The harmonization of standards improves product safety and quality, helps to reduce technical barriers for manufacturers, and expands opportunities for domestic enterprises to enter international markets.
It is planned to continue working in this direction to increase the rate of harmonization with international standards.
The activities of the Uzbek Agency for Technical Regulation are essential for the sustainable development of the national economy and increasing the country’s export potential.
